pdfjava话题讨论。解读pdfjava知识,想了解学习pdfjava,请参与pdfjava话题讨论。
pdfjava话题已于 2025-08-13 14:52:34 更新
在方法内部,首先创建一个FileInputStream对象,然后使用PDFParser解析该文件。接着,通过PDDocument对象获取PDF文档的内容,最后使用PDFTextStripper提取文本。示例代码如下:java import java.io.*;import org.pdfbox.pdmodel.PDDocument;import org.pdfbox.pdfparser.PDFParser;import org.pdfbox.util.PDFText...
Word文档的导出: 选用工具:使用Apache POI包。 实现流程: 设置模板:首先,需设置固定格式的Word文档模板,将需要动态填充的内容以特定符号替代。 读取并替换:通过Java代码读取Word模板,将模板中的符号替换为实际的数据内容。 生成文档:完成替换后,将生成最终的Word文档并导出。PDF文档的导出...
在Java中将HTML转为PDF的方法主要有两种:使用xhtmlrenderer:依赖环境:首先确保Java环境已正确安装并配置。引入依赖:在项目中引入xhtmlrenderer的依赖库。代码实现:编写Java代码,调用xhtmlrenderer的API,传入HTML内容,并指定输出PDF文件的路径。注意事项:需确保代码路径正确,所有依赖文件都在可访问的目录...
public static void main(String[] args) { // 加载PDF文件 PdfDocument pdfDocument = new PdfDocument();pdfDocument.loadFromFile("example.pdf");// 转换为Word格式 pdfDocument.saveToFile("ToWord.docx", FileFormat.DOCX);} } 这段代码展示了如何使用Free Spire.PDF for Java库将PDF文件转换...
为了实现Java使用pdfbox按行读取PDF内容,首先需加载PDF文档并创建一个PDDocument对象,此步骤为初始化阶段。接着,创建一个PDFTextStripper对象,并通过设置起始页码和结束页码来指定读取范围,进一步定位至所需文本区域。紧接着,使用PDFTextStripper对象将PDF文档的全部内容提取为一个字符串,此步骤为内容提取...
在Java中生成PDF文档时,你可以使用iText库来处理图片并将其转换为PDF。具体来说,你可以通过以下步骤完成这一任务。首先,你需要创建一个PDF文档对象,例如:Document doc = new Document(null, 0, 0, 0, 0);。然后,你需要通过指定图片路径获取图片对象,例如:Image image = Image.getInstance(img...
01PDFBox 这是Apache提供的一个免费、开源工具,专门用于操作PDF文档,目前支持加密/解密PDF文档,从PDF文档中导出表单数据,向已有PDF文档追加内容,以及切分PDF文档等,导入项目或工程的话,可以直接下载Jar包,也可以直接Maven引入,如下:02Spire.PDF 这也是一个专门用于读取PDF文件内容的Java工具包,商业...
在Java中,生成双层PDF的过程相对复杂,需要使用到一些特定的库和工具。比如,可以使用Apache PDFBox和Tesseract OCR库来实现。首先,使用PDFBox读取扫描图像文件,然后进行去污和纠偏处理。接着,通过Tesseract将图像转换为文本,并将文本信息嵌入到PDF文件的下层。最后,将处理后的PDF文件保存,形成双层结构。
iText PDF Java API 入门介绍教程:一、iText简介 定义:iText是一个功能强大的Java库,专门用于创建和操作PDF文档。功能:支持生成包含文本、表格、图像等丰富内容的PDF文档,同时提供PDF/A支持、数字签名、加密等功能,满足复杂PDF处理需求。特点:iText非常灵活和强大,允许根据具体需求进行大量定制和扩展。
Java快速生成PDF文档,推荐使用xeasypdf工具类。以下是关于xeasypdf的详细介绍:直观易用的接口:xeasypdf提供了直观的接口设计,使得开发者能够轻松构建PDF文档,操作简便,如同拼积木一般。强大的功能:该工具类封装了pdfbox和fop库,功能强大,可以满足各种PDF生成和编辑需求。无论是编辑PDF内容,还是进行...